At the 2025 Met Gala, Indian-American entrepreneur Mona Patel captivated attendees with her striking fashion statement, blending cultural elements with futuristic style. Following her impressive debut at the 2024 event, Patel walked the blue carpet at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, turning heads with her innovative outfit.
Her look, a one-of-a-kind Thom Browne creation, featured a robotic dog on a diamond leash, enhancing her bold entrance. The robotic dog, “Vector,” inspired by Thom Browne’s Hector Bag, added a unique touch to her ensemble. Patel’s outfit included a sharp tailored suit, highlighted by a black, beaded corset-style bodice and a halter-neck shirt. She completed the look with a 1000-carat emerald-cut diamond necklace, a kinetic spine feature from Lisa Jiang and Timothy Bowl, and a dramatic hat from Miodrag Gubernic. Her Rene Caovilla shoes perfectly complemented the ensemble.

Who is Mona Patel?
Mona Patel is a serial entrepreneur, investor, and philanthropist with a diverse portfolio spanning healthcare, technology, and real estate. With education from Harvard, Stanford, and MIT, Patel has founded several successful businesses and regularly speaks at global forums like the World Economic Forum. Known for her commitment to gender equity and economic inclusion, Patel’s philanthropic efforts focus on women’s entrepreneurship and girls’ education. She also collects haute couture and uses her foundation, Couture for Cause, to support long-term, sustainable social impact.
